PostPosted: Wed Jul 01, 2009 10:20 am    Post subject: Reply with quote

Rachel wrote:

Yeah , I think he would turn it down. It’s a fine line between success at work and success at home. Like your work. Love your family. Why has Chris never filled-in for Sir T when he’s been on holiday? Surely he would if he really wanted that slot.


Maybe not. Part of the deal when Johnnie Walker was told that Drivetime was no longer his was that he would continue to deputise for Sir Terry of Wogan. The breakfast stand-in gig may simply not be available if Walker has a contract to that effect.

Besides, the "stand in" has a difficult job to do. Drivetime these days is very structured; Evans seems to like that. He doesn't have to think about what's coming next because it's second nature; all his effort can go into projecting energy around the structure. Give him two hours where the only feature is Pause for Thought and he would have a massive change of mental gear to do. He would struggle to settle before Wogan got back.

From both Chris's and the management's point of view, it's much better to put someone like Walker in the slot, who is well known and is comfortable making something from very little for a couple of weeks.

If/when Evans is given the breakfast show, he will make it his own with regular features and a very different style to Wogan. He will, of course, alienate a lot of listeners, but others will be attracted and his figures after a year will stand a chance of returning to their former level - if he's the right man for the job. If not, they won't! Very Happy

Rob.
